How to manage digital resources and notes for seamless retrieval and integration across study topics.
Efficient digital organization transforms scattered notes into a cohesive study ecosystem, enabling quick retrieval, cross-topic synthesis, and steady academic progress through disciplined systems, thoughtful tagging, and regular maintenance habits.

In today’s information-rich classrooms, the way you organize digital resources can either accelerate learning or create frustrating dead ends. Start with a central, reliable storage location that you can trust to hold PDFs, slides, web clippings, and note files. Structure it with a simple, consistent hierarchy: main folders for subjects, subfolders for topics, and further subdivisions for assignments or reading lists. Implement a naming convention that captures essential data, such as date, topic, and source, so you can identify the file at a glance. This upfront planning saves time during intense study sessions and reduces the cognitive load of hunting for materials later.
Once your repository is shaped, establish a deliberate workflow for adding new resources. Clip, download, or forward items into the appropriate folders promptly, avoiding procrastination that leads to chaos. As you build your collection, attach brief notes or annotations that summarize the key ideas, arguments, or data points. Use a consistent format for these notations, such as a one-line takeaway followed by a short paragraph of context. By creating this connective layer, you’ll turn raw materials into usable knowledge and make it easier to link ideas across courses or topics.
Build a cross-topic retrieval system through consistent linking and synthesis.
The next pillar is a robust tagging strategy that mirrors your cognitive map of the material. Words or short phrases function as signposts, allowing you to locate related elements across different folders. Use a finite set of tags representing core concepts, authors, methodologies, and study goals. For example, tags might include "experimental design," "theory X," "case study," and "exam prep." Consistency in tagging is crucial: apply the same tags to all relevant items, regardless of where they originated. This practice enables powerful, flexible searches and the discovery of connections you might otherwise miss.

Integrate your notes with your references so you can reconstruct an argument quickly. Create a practice of linking a citation or source to the notes you generate from it. In your notes, note the page or slide where a claim appears and, if possible, quote succinctly. When you review, you should be able to trace an idea from source to understanding with ease. To support this, consider using a single reference manager that can also host PDFs and link them to your notes. The objective is a seamless trail from source material to personal synthesis.
Create a personal index for your evolving understanding and routines.
A powerful habit is to periodically review and reorganize your digital library. Schedule brief, focused sessions weekly to prune outdated files, merge duplicate items, and refine tags. Ask practical questions during these reviews: Is this resource still relevant? Does it belong in a different topic folder? Does the tag accurately reflect the core concept? By reassessing your collection, you prevent stagnation and ensure your materials stay aligned with evolving study goals. The act of cleaning also reinforces memory: you re-encode information and reinforce the mental map you rely on during exams or projects.

Beyond organization, consider developing a personal index that captures your evolving understanding. A concise digital notebook or micro-SOP (standard operating procedure) can outline how you approach different subjects, what sources you trust, and how you synthesize material. Include entry templates that remind you to summarize, question assumptions, and note implications. This index becomes your study compass, guiding future searches and helping you connect ideas across topics. Regularly updating it solidifies routines and reduces the likelihood that valuable insights will languish unread.

The ritual of regular backups cannot be overlooked. Protect your work by enabling automatic cloud backups and maintaining local copies on an encrypted drive. Synchronize across devices to ensure you can access everything whether you’re on a campus computer, a personal laptop, or a tablet. Turn on version history where possible; it lets you recover previous states if a file becomes corrupted or you realize an earlier interpretation was incorrect. Backups are a safety net for the long haul, giving you confidence to experiment with new organization methods without risking loss.
When you work with a team or share materials with classmates, create a collaborative layer that preserves your personal structure while allowing efficient exchange. Use shared folders for group projects, but keep your own private workspace separate for individual study notes. Establish norms for naming shared documents and for how edits are tracked. This balance protects your private, reflective notes while enabling productive collaboration. Clear communication about where to place items and how to tag them will prevent misalignment and keep everyone operating from a common, reliable resource base.

A practical approach to retrieval speed is to implement a quick-access index with minimal friction. Create a master list of high-demand topics, with each entry containing a short description, key sources, and the most important takeaways. Keep this index lightweight so you can skim it rapidly during a study sprint. Pair it with quick-reference bookmarks or a favorites system in your browser for online sources. The goal is to reduce cognitive load during problem-solving by giving you an immediate springboard into relevant ideas and evidence.
In tandem with speed, cultivate a habit of deliberate, reflective encoding. After you read or watch something, immediately distill what mattered in a few sentences, then record why it matters for your current or future work. This practice solidifies comprehension and makes retrieval more reliable. Avoid clutter by focusing on depth rather than breadth: a handful of well-understood sources will outperform a sprawling pile of superficially treated materials. Through consistent summarization, your notes accumulate clarity and become more usable across different study topics.
Finally, tailor your system to your unique learning style and course demands. Some students thrive with visual organizers and mind maps, while others prefer linear prose and checklists. Experiment with different formats and observe what actually helps you remember and apply information. The right mix balances structure with flexibility, furnishing a stable framework that still accommodates new kinds of content. Periodically reassess your approach and adjust thresholds for tagging, linking, and archiving. A personalized system is not fixed; it grows with you as your coursework expands or shifts emphasis.
As you develop mastery, your digital resources become more than storage; they become a personal knowledge base. The consolidated network of notes, sources, and reflections reveals patterns across topics, supporting deeper understanding and transfer to new problems. You’ll experience fewer last-minute scrambles before exams, smoother authoring of essays, and quicker synthesis for projects. In the end, the effort to maintain an integrated, well-tagged repository pays dividends in learning efficiency, confidence, and the capacity to connect ideas across the entire spectrum of your studies.
